Getting clients or portfolio workStart with your own site

Take whatever you can get at first

List who you know & who needs help

Nonprofits, beginning blogger, small biz you love

Design and promote your own pet projects

On Pricing & PackagesStart somewhere & increase prices with experience, skill & demandIt’s all about expectations on both sidesAim for $100 an hourYour choice on hourly or project based pricingMake sure you are building to full-time & using time & energy wiselyThree packages to offer initially:

Blog, Getting Started Website, and “Custom”

Your websiteThe home and hub for all you do

Keep the lawn perfect and green

It’s your showroom

5 areas to start with: About, Contact, Services, Portfolio & Blog

Advice for Outsourcing“Don’t outsource your soul.”

“Don’t outsource your core competency.”

Outsource the things you don’t do well

Outsource the thigns you hate or drain your energy & passion

Look for & work with good partners

Saturday, November 12, 11

Attributes of Good Partners

Dependable & Deliver

Good communicators

Experienced & Qualified

Like-Minded
